> > Where do we read PAT2 and PAT3, I see you defined those newly and
> > patch 2/2 has them
> > in teh switch case but the drm_dp_get_phy_test_pattern function
> > doesnt read them?
> >
>
> Per my understanding from the specs, only HBR2 (CP2520 PAT1) requires
> reading dpcd address 0024Ah to set HBR2_COMPLIANCT_SCRAMBLER_RESET.
> TPS4 (CP2520 PAT3) doesn’t require that.
> I’m not sure about CP2520 PAT2 if it has use or not. In the test scope
> we can select 6 patterns. PAT2 is not one of them.
